Re: New Video Card Help

256bit (7900) vs 128bit (8600) is the biggest difference. its the bandwith, and this is not nearly a good enough example but its like 128K dial up and 256K. the 8600 does have faster clock speeds, but the bandwith difference makes up for it and more, as the 7900 regularly outperforms the 8600.
